Intensive Glucose Control May Cut Kidney Damage in Half
A University of Washington researcher, whose study tracked over 1,300 diabetes patients since 1983, recently reported that extremely tight glucose control in the early stages of the disease can reduce a diabetic’s risk of kidney failure by 50%.
